When homeowners search for how new windows improve curb appeal and comfort, they are often considering a variety of home improvement goals. Typically, this topic relates to efforts to enhance the visual attractiveness of a property’s exterior while also making indoor spaces more comfortable and energy-efficient. Many people are interested in updating older, outdated windows that may be damaged, inefficient, or simply not matching the style of their home anymore. This search often arises from a desire to boost property value, modernize the home’s appearance, or reduce drafts and temperature fluctuations that can make living spaces less comfortable.
This topic is closely linked to common home improvement projects that involve replacing or upgrading windows. Problems that prompt these searches include visible signs of wear, such as cracked or foggy glass, warped frames, or difficulty opening and closing windows. Homeowners may also have plans to improve energy efficiency, reduce heating and cooling costs, or eliminate noise infiltration. These considerations are especially relevant in homes where windows are aging or poorly insulated, making new window installations a practical step toward resolving these issues. How do new windows enhance curb appeal? New windows can significantly improve a home's exterior appearance by offering modern styles, cleaner lines, and updated finishes that match current design trends, helping to create a more attractive look for the property.
In what ways can new windows improve home comfort? Installing new windows can reduce drafts, minimize heat transfer, and improve insulation, leading to a more consistent indoor temperature and increased comfort throughout the home.
How do local contractors help with improving curb appeal and comfort through window installation? Local service providers have the expertise to select appropriate window styles and perform professional installation, ensuring that new windows maximize both aesthetic appeal and energy efficiency.
What types of window features contribute to better curb appeal and comfort? Features such as energy-efficient glass, decorative grids, and modern frame materials can enhance visual appeal while also improving insulation and reducing noise.
Why is professional window installation important for achieving curb appeal and comfort benefits? Skilled local contractors ensure that windows are properly fitted and sealed, which is essential for maximizing the aesthetic improvements and comfort enhancements that new windows can provide.
